1Athlete Dissent as Disrespectful on World Stage
The host asserts that Team USA athletes making political statements or expressing 'mixed emotions' about representing the country at the Olympics is a profound act of disrespect. He argues that while domestic political disagreements are permissible, the world stage demands a unified, proud representation of the nation.
Freestyle skier Hunter Hess stated he had 'mixed emotions' about wearing the stars and stripes, noting 'a lot going on that I'm not the biggest fan of'. Figure skater Amber Glenn spoke out for the LGBTQ community, stating it's been 'a hard time' under the current administration and that 'politics affect us all'. The host frames these as 'trashing America and the president'.
